PFB와 TTF는 디지털 디자인에서 사용되는 두 가지 일반적인 폰트 형식입니다. PFB(포스트스크립트 폰트 이진)는 이전 형식이며, TTF(TrueType 폰트)는 더 현대적이고 널리 지원됩니다. PFB 폰트를 가지고 있고 TTF가 필요한 프로젝트에서 사용해야 하는 경우, 변환이 필요합니다. 이 가이드에서는 JavaScript를 사용하여 PFB를 TTF로 변환하는 방법을 안내합니다.
이 기사에서는 다음 주제를 다룹니다:
JavaScript 라이브러리로 PFB를 TTF로 변환하기
PFB를 TTF로 변환하기 위해 Aspose.Font for JavaScript 라이브러리를 사용합니다. 이 라이브러리는 PFB 폰트를 TTF 형식으로 변환하는 작업을 간소화합니다. Aspose.Font를 사용하면 JavaScript 애플리케이션에 폰트 변환 기능을 쉽게 통합할 수 있어, 다양한 플랫폼과 장치에서 호환성을 보장합니다. 개발자는 여러 형식의 폰트 데이터를 조작하고 추출하며 관리할 수 있습니다.
라이브러리를 다운로드하고 Aspose.Font for JavaScript 설치 방법을 따르세요.
JavaScript를 사용하여 PFB를 TTF로 변환하기
웹 애플리케이션 내에서 JavaScript를 사용하여 PFB 폰트를 TTF 형식으로 빠르게 변환할 수 있습니다. PFB 파일을 로드한 다음 TTF로 변환합니다. 메인 UI 스레드를 차단하지 않도록 웹 워커 스레드가 무거운 작업을 수행합니다. 이로 인해 변환 애플리케이션이 사용자 친화적이 되고, 변환 과정이 단순화되며, 파일 다운로드가 효율적으로 이루어집니다.
JavaScript를 사용하여 PFB 폰트를 TrueType 폰트로 변환하는 방법은 다음과 같습니다:
- 다음 코드 조각을 사용하여 웹 워커를 생성합니다:
- 다음 단계에 따라 PFB를 TTF로 변환합니다:
- 변환할 PFB 파일을 선택합니다.
FileReader
객체를 생성합니다.AsposeFontConvertToSVG
함수를 실행합니다.json.fileNameResult
에 출력 파일의 이름을 설정합니다.json.errorCode
가 0인지 확인합니다. 0이면 변환된 파일의 링크를 가져옵니다. 그렇지 않으면 오류 세부정보가json.errorText
에 있습니다.DownloadFile
함수는 다운로드 링크를 생성하여 변환된 파일을 컴퓨터로 다운로드할 수 있게 합니다.
다음 코드 샘플은 JavaScript를 사용하여 PFB 폰트 파일을 TTF 형식으로 변환하는 방법을 보여줍니다.
무료 온라인 PFB를 TTF로 변환하기
이 무료 온라인 PFB를 TTF로 변환하기 도구를 사용하여 PFB 파일을 TTF로 변환할 수 있습니다. 모든 장치에서 사용 가능한 웹 브라우저를 통해 접근할 수 있습니다.
JavaScript 폰트 라이브러리 받기
제한 없이 JavaScript 폰트 라이브러리를 사용해보려면 무료 임시 라이센스를 받을 수 있습니다.
PFB를 TTF로 - 무료 리소스
PFB 폰트를 TrueType 폰트로 변환하는 것 외에도 다음 리소스를 통해 라이브러리의 다양한 기능을 탐색해보세요:
결론
이 기사에서는 JavaScript를 사용하여 PFB 폰트를 TTF 형식으로 변환하는 방법을 배웠습니다. Aspose.Font for JavaScript를 사용하여 강력하고 효율적인 폰트 변환 솔루션을 제공하며, 빠른 변환을 위해 온라인 도구를 사용할 수도 있습니다. 이러한 단계를 따르면 더 넓은 범위의 애플리케이션과 장치에서 호환성을 쉽게 보장할 수 있습니다. 질문이 있으면 무료 지원 포럼에서 문의해 주세요.